How much do home base data entry j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for home base data entry in Georgia is $16.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.80 and $18.46 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a home base data entry?

A Home Base Data Entry job involves entering, updating, or managing data from the comfort of your home. This role typically requires strong typing skills, attention to detail, and basic computer proficiency. Tasks may include inputting data into spreadsheets, databases, or company systems. Many employers provide training, and jobs can be full-time, part-time, or freelance. Reliable internet and a computer are usually necessary for remote work.

What does a home base data entry do?

A typical day in a Home Base Data Entry position involves entering, updating, and verifying various types of information in digital systems, often from the comfort of your own home. You may receive tasks through company portals or email, and are usually expected to manage your workload independently while meeting daily or weekly targets. Communication with supervisors or team members generally occurs through instant messaging platforms, video calls, or email. This structure allows for flexibility but also requires strong organizational skills to ensure data is accurate and submitted on time. Over time, experienced professionals in this field may take on more complex assignments or supervisory responsibilities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in home base data entry?

To thrive as a Home Base Data Entry professional, you need excellent typing abilities, attention to detail,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with productivity software such as Microsoft Excel, Google Sheets, and various company-specific databases or CRM systems is commonly required. Strong time management, self-motivation, and clear communication skills help remote data entry workers excel in independent and collaborative tasks. These qualities ensure accuracy, efficiency, and reliability when handling important business information in a remote setting.

Job description

Data Entry SpecialistCompany Overview

Pan-Am Dental Laboratory is a full-service dental laboratory that partners with dental professionals to design and fabricate a wide range of dental restorations and appliances. With a focus on quality, consistency and clinical accuracy, Pan-Am Prides itself with happy patients and happy business partners.  Headquartered in Savannah, GA, Pan-Am Has two additional locations in Houston, TX and Sandy, UT – allowing us to serve a base of clients covering the entire country.

Position Summary

The Data Entry Specialist plays a critical role in the accuracy and efficiency of our operations by ensuring all customer cases are entered into our system quickly, precisely, and with exceptional attention to detail. As a key member of our team, this individual helps establish the foundation on which every successful dental restoration is built.

This position goes far beyond traditional data entry. It offers the opportunity to gain hands-on exposure to dental products, terminology, and laboratory workflows. The ideal candidate is highly organized, dependable, and committed to quality, but also curious and eager to deepen their understanding of the dental process—from initial prescription all the way to the final restoration delivered to the patient.

In this role, you’ll develop real industry knowledge, contribute to smooth case transitions, and play an essential part in ensuring that each case is set up for success from the very beginning.

Key Responsibilities
  • Receive and process both digital and analog cases; open cases, verify contents, and review customer order requirements
  • Accurately enter all incoming case information into the computer system and generate corresponding work tickets.
  • Assign proper coding to cases for data entry and workflow routing
  • Update and maintain computer work tickets, including placing cases on hold and adjusting dates, codes or other critical information as needed
  • Scan and electronically archive paperwork for each case in accordance with documentation protocols
  • Retrieve historical paperwork or case files as needed for case clarification, reworks, or reference
  • Organize and manage digital impressions and case records following established laboratory procedures
  • Continuously expand knowledge of dental terminology, restorative products, and laboratory processes to ensure accuracy and efficiency
  • Understand and follow the established case flow and scheduling operations
  • Perform additional duties or tasks as assigned to support team and laboratory operations
Qualifications & Requirements
  • Proficiency with computers, file management and applications
  • Able to pick up software programs (magic Touch) with ease
  • Have practical knowledge of customer service practices and principles
  • Excellent data entry and typing skills
  • Superior listening, verbal, and written communication skills
  • Understand different script terminologies for case entry
  • Must be able to read, write, speak, and understand English
  • Strong attention to detail
  • Can successfully multi-task
  • Knowledge of dental anatomy and terminology preferred, but not required
